Set the slide-switch function-selector to the “3~Bal • 1~” Power position. Setup
power measurements as mentioned in the previous “Single-Phase Power &
3-Phase Balanced-Load Power functions” section
• To start (“
”) kWHr Recording, press “3~Bal • 1~” and “HOLD”
buttons at the same time. Annunciator “ ” turns on & flashes. kWHr
accumulated time (in Hour) is displayed automatically in the secondary
mini display.
• To pause (“
”), press “HOLD” button momentarily. Annunciator “ ”
stops flashing and is always on.
• To continue (“
”), press the “HOLD” button momentarily again.
Annunciator “ ” resumes flashing.
• To stop (“
”), press the “3~Bal • 1~” and “HOLD” buttons at the
same time again. Annunciator “ ” turns off. The kWHr Recording result

Note:
• During kWHr Recording session, real-time W, VAR, VA as well as kWHr
accumulated readings can be selected by pressing the SELECT button
momentarily. A flashing “ ” denotes that kWHr Recording is still under-
going. An always on “ ” denotes that kWHr Recording is being paused.
• When kWHr Recording is not activated, kWHr stored result instead
of accumulated readings is displayed when selected as in above.
Annunciator “
” turns on & flashes.
• The meter separately stores one Single-Phase and one 3-Phase-Balanced-
Load kWHr result for later viewing. When they are being viewed, press
“3~Bal • 1~” button momentarily to toggle between them.
• When the display readings exceed 9999kWHr/999hours, exponential
readings are displayed. “2.3E4” kWHr represents 2.3 x 104 kWHr, or
23000 kWHr for example,.
